Output e8b8f4e21ef65953bff42a32ed16576cc3668ccb1b9a3e7a43b89b3930f604ce:1

value
3620963
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b7f1898b78cc6aa2ed324e8f78057c0b8446a9d4 OP_EQUAL
address
3JTcvxFgKon3H5X9aH3EwqgL7wa7M16bjM
transaction
e8b8f4e21ef65953bff42a32ed16576cc3668ccb1b9a3e7a43b89b3930f604ce
spent
true